Strong graduate outcomes — known for health sciences
Linfield University is a private institution in McMinnville with particular strength in health sciences and business.
A small campus of 1.6K undergraduates with a 10:1 student-faculty ratio. The town location creates a classic college-town feel.
65% of students graduate within four years, and graduates earn a median of $78,638 a decade after enrollment. Net price after aid averages $27,341.

History & Fun Facts
- •(October 2024) The 1800s Linfield traces its history back to the earliest days of Oregon Territory, when pioneer Baptists in Oregon City created the Oregon Baptist Educational Society in 1848.
- •This society was organized to establish a Baptist school in the region, which began as Oregon City College in 1849.
- •Other accounts indicate that the Baptist group purchased the land in 1857 in order to start their school.
- •The Oregon Territorial Legislature chartered the Baptist College at McMinnville in 1858.
